235-252 of 471 vehicles
£27,870
£23,042
£52,845
£70,120
£31,843
£52,110
£49,758
£74,189
£32,274
£48,510
£34,825
£33,019
£27,072
£65,773
£49,402
£60,488
£51,263
£79,341